Handover note — Director Hale Brennick to Director Sora Veld. The transition of Quillmark accounts to annual billing begins next quarter. Finance should reconcile prorated monthly balances before migration and flag any deferred-revenue adjustments. Invoicing templates are updated; collections policy is unchanged. Sora assumes ownership from the first. The strategic reasoning is summarised below.

board note of fahif-yahog: Gross margin on Wenath came in at 10 percent against a plan of 5 percent. Only 3 of the 100 pilot accounts renewed Wenath, so a churn review is set for July 15.

**Step 4: Configure Spokelift**

Before the rebalancing worker starts, copy `env.sample` to `.env` and set REBALANCE_INTERVAL_MIN (we use 15 in Harwick City). The worker pulls live dock counts from the fleet API, and that connection needs its access secret, which you add on the next line.

env line for fafof-fahag: LEDGER_TOKEN5=f8790

# Cronmigrate client setup.
# We moved the legacy cron jobs (billing sweep, digest sender,
# stale-session pruner) onto the Taskforge workflow engine.
# New team members: do not add crontab entries; define a Taskforge
# workflow instead. This client registers workflows and triggers runs.
# It authenticates to the internal Taskforge API with the key below.

gateway credential: kto3_qfe

MEMO — Marketing Budget Reduction

To: Board of Directors
From: Office of the CFO

Effective next quarter, the marketing budget will be reduced by 18%, concentrated in trade events and print campaigns for the Brindlewick product line. Digital acquisition spend is preserved, as it remains our most efficient channel. The Vossler rebrand project is paused, not cancelled. Savings will be redirected per the strategic plan. The confidential note below summarises the relevant business plans.

internal memo for hahif-hahaf: Headcount on the Zorwyn team goes from 9 to 100 by the end of October. Gross margin on Zorwyn came in at 5 percent against a plan of 10 percent.

Action item from the Graniteware outage: split the user module out of the Coreledger monolith before the next major release. Auth and profile code must ship behind separate deploy gates; no combined rollbacks after the split. Release manager owns the cutover checklist. The migration schedule and gating criteria live on the internal page below.

runbook for hawif-tajeg: https://grafana.plorvasoft.example/dash